§ 37-2-37 — Franchisee may not be prevented from selling renewable fuels in lieu of one grade of gasoline.

South Dakota·Title 37 TRADE REGULATION·Ch. 37-1 PETROLEUM PRODUCTS
No franchise-related document that requires that three grades of gasoline be sold by the applicable franchisee may prevent the franchisee from selling one or more renewable fuels in lieu of one, and only one, grade of gasoline.

Legislative History

SL 2008, ch 201, § 4; SL 2011, ch 188, § 3.
